PLC(可编程逻辑控制器)是一种用于工业自动化的电子设备,它能够根据预设的程序来控制和监视各种工业过程。PLC编程设备是实现PLC编程的工具,它包括了多种关键组件和功能,以支持用户进行有效的编程和调试。以下是PLC编程设备的关键组件与功能概览:
1. 编程器/软件:这是PLC编程设备的核心部分,通常是一个便携式计算机或专用的编程器。编程器/软件提供了一种图形化界面,使用户能够编写、修改和测试PLC程序。常见的编程器/软件有西门子的STEP 7、罗克韦尔的RSLogix和施耐德的Eplan等。
2. 输入/输出模块:这些是连接PLC与其他设备(如传感器、执行器等)的接口。输入模块负责接收外部信号,而输出模块则将处理后的数据发送到外部设备。输入/输出模块的类型和数量取决于所需的I/O点数。
3. 通信接口:PLC编程设备需要与其他设备(如上位机、人机界面等)进行通信。常见的通信接口有以太网、串口、USB等。这些接口使得PLC能够与外部系统进行数据交换和远程监控。
4. 电源:PLC编程设备需要稳定的电源供应,以确保其正常运行。常见的电源类型有24VDC、220VAC等。
5. 辅助设备:除了上述主要组件外,PLC编程设备还可能包括一些辅助设备,如打印机、扫描仪等。这些设备可以帮助用户打印程序、生成报告等。
6. 编程语言:PLC编程设备通常支持多种编程语言,如梯形图、指令列表、结构化文本等。用户可以根据需要选择适合的编程语言进行编程。
7. 仿真工具:为了确保程序的正确性,PLC编程设备通常配备了仿真工具。这些工具可以在不实际连接硬件的情况下模拟PLC程序的运行情况,帮助用户发现并修复潜在的错误。
8. 调试工具:PLC编程设备通常配备了一系列调试工具,如断点设置、单步执行、变量监视等。这些工具可以帮助用户逐步检查和修改程序,确保程序的正确性和稳定性。
总之,PLC编程设备的关键组件与功能涵盖了从编程环境到硬件支持等多个方面。通过这些工具和资源,用户可以有效地进行PLC编程,实现对工业过程的精确控制和优化。